Job Description




As a Security Officer - Industrial Access Driver in Pontiac, IL,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Manufacturing & Industrial, and more. As an Allied Universal Security Officer in a manufacturing and industrial location, you will manage access control by welcoming employees and visitors, verifying credentials, issuing passes, and documenting activity. You will perform routine patrols and security-related checks to help to deter incidents, respond to concerns, and communicate clearly with site leaders. This is a driving post requiring a valid drivers license under AU Driver Policy Requirements, supporting mobile rounds and rapid response.

What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to employees, contractors, drivers, and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Control access at entry points by verifying identification and/or credentials, issuing visitor passes per site procedures, maintaining visitor and contractor logs, and coordinating with site contacts for approvals.
  • Screen inbound and outbound pedestrian and vehicle traffic for compliance with posted requirements, including directing deliveries to designated areas and reporting suspicious activity per protocol.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including documenting events and notifying appropriate site contacts and Allied Universal supervision as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around the facility, production areas, parking lots, and perimeter, noting unusual conditions and reporting maintenance and/or security-related concerns.
